The total market cap for all cryptocurrencies has lost $2 billion over the last 24 hours. Bitcoin is currently trading at around $6,374.
The crypto markets have fallen in value over the last 24 hours and most currencies have lost in value. At the time of writing, about 75 of the 100 biggest cryptocurrencies show red numbers.
The total market cap for all cryptocurrencies has lost $2 billion over the last 24 hours – from $207 billion yesterday to $205 billion today.
When we look at the biggest cryptocurrencies, they show mixed numbers over the last 24 hours. Eos (-1,87%), bitcoin (-1,13%) and ethereum (-0,37%) have lost value over the past day, while xrp (+1,44%) and bitcoin cash (+0,24%) show increases in value.
Bitcoin (-1,13%) is currently trading at around $6,374, which is $70 lower than yesterday.
The top 100 cryptocurrencies that performed the best during the last day were ravencoin (+10,61%) and reddcoin (+5,58%), and those who performed the worst were digitex futures (-17,65%) and verataseum (-15,86%).
